Adam Ramzi Reveals How He Feels About ‘Severance’ Season 2: ‘It’s Giving Fancy ‘Lost’’

Severance Season 2 ended, earning rave reviews from critics and mixed-positive reactions from audiences. Gay porn star Adam Ramzi shared his thoughts on the season with a funny comparison.

Adam spent his recovery day binging Severance Season 2 and took to Instagram to humorously express his thoughts on the show.

“It’s giving fancy Lost,” Adam said. “It’s giving Lost with a budget. It’s giving Lost Apple Premium. It’s giving Lost without the 22-episode season order. It’s giving Lost without the network TV of the 2000s drama and visual effects budget/lack thereof. It’s giving Lost of the new digital age we’re in, 20 years later. Lost 20 years later.”

He continued: “Abstract, ambitious existentialism. Yeah. It’s giving we have to go back to the island, except it’s an office. Is it purgatory, is it Hell? It’s obnoxious. I hate it and I love it. Well done.”
